The trial in Oakland, California between Elon Musk and Sam Altman has highlighted the intense competition and oversized personalities in the artificial intelligence sector. As the legal proceedings unfold, the AI industry itself could emerge as the primary beneficiary, gaining greater public scrutiny and regulatory attention.

The high-profile trial pits Elon Musk, CEO of Tesla and founder of xAI, against Sam Altman, CEO of OpenAI, over allegations related to the direction and governance of the AI startup. Court documents and testimony have revealed internal tensions and strategic disagreements that had previously remained behind closed doors. The proceedings in Oakland have lifted the veil on decision-making processes within leading AI labs, including how funding, research priorities, and corporate structures are managed. Witnesses have described a culture of intense rivalry and vast ambition. While the legal outcome remains uncertain, the trial has already prompted deeper media coverage and public discussion about the ethical and competitive dynamics shaping the AI landscape. Both Musk and Altman have denied the most serious claims, and the case continues to generate interest from investors and technologists worldwide.

The key takeaway from the trial is that the AI industry may gain from increased transparency, as the case exposes the strategic thinking and competitive pressures driving two of its most influential figures. Market observers note that such public legal disputes could accelerate calls for clearer governance frameworks around AI development. Historically, similar high-stakes trials in technology have led to greater regulatory oversight and industry self-policing. Additionally, the trial underscores the growing economic significance of AI: major companies are investing billions in research and infrastructure, and the outcome of this case might influence how partnerships and intellectual property are structured in the future. However, no direct financial impact on any specific company has been established from the proceedings themselves.

From an investment perspective, the trial highlights the potential for ongoing volatility and heightened regulatory risk in the AI sector. While no near-term changes to earnings or market valuations can be predicted, the publicity could lead to increased public and political debate about AI safety and monopolistic practices. Investors may want to monitor any policy developments that could affect competitive dynamics among AI firms. Caution is warranted, as legal battles among key industry figures often produce unpredictable outcomes. The broader perspective suggests that the AI industry's growth trajectory remains strong, but governance challenges may continue to emerge as the technology matures.
